General info

Kiptopeke Fishing Pier and Breakwater is a part of an ocean located in Northampton County, Virginia, United States. It is most popular for fishing Summer flounder, Atlantic cutlassfish, and Spotted seatrout.

🪪 Do I need a fishing license to fish at Kiptopeke Fishing Pier and Breakwater?

Fishing in Virginia requires a valid state fishing license for anglers. Licenses include resident and non-resident, annual, short-term, and combination options, available online or from licensed agents.

In Virginia, no fishing license is required for anglers under 16 or residents 65 and older. A few other exceptions worth knowing:

  • Free fishing days — most states designate 1–2 weekends a year where anyone can fish without a license

  • Tribal waters — tribal members fishing on tribal land operate under separate tribal regulations

  • Private ponds — landowners fishing their own water typically don't need a license

Non-residents usually pay more for a license than residents. Some species also require an extra stamp or endorsement on top of your base license.
